Is nickel mining a good investment?
Direct investment in nickel mining equities or physical commodities offers high-beta exposure to global industrialization, aerospace alloys, and the clean energy transition. However, mining operations face substantial capital expenditure requirements, complex geopolitical risks in major producing nations like Indonesia, and stringent environmental regulatory hurdles. Consequently, analysts recommend focusing exclusively on tier-one mining operators with low-cost structural assets, strong balance sheets, and robust ESG compliance profiles to weather commodity cycles successfully.
